Management of mineral and bone disorders in patients on dialysis: a team approach to improving outcomes

Michelle Carver et al. Nephrol Nurs J. 2008 May-Jun.

Abstract

Most patients with mineral and bone disorders do not simultaneously achieve KDOQI target goals for parathyroid hormone, calcium, phosphorus, and the calcium-phosphorus product. A multidisciplinary team composed of the patient, nephrologists, nephrology nurses, renal dietitians, social workers, patient care technicians, clinical pharmacists, and physical therapists can help improve the coordination of care for mineral and bone disorders. The roles of team members are reviewed, with emphasis on nephrology nurses.
